This 24-hour wear foundation revitalizes the skin and gives you a younger look, without inducing more oiliness. The natural finish goes above and beyond what many specific “acne” foundations can do. This sucker is actually spiked with salicylic acid to unclog pores and even out the texture of your skin. It also boasts hyaluronic acid, which will plump up any dry spots. This foundation comes in 50 shades and is buildable until you reach the amount of coverage you are comfortable with. It won’t fade and it won’t give oily skin the time of day – it’s truly budge-free. This foundation is packed with perlite and silica to absorb oil and mattify the skin. 

Eternalsoft polymers are responsible for the increased amount of ease you feel while you wear it all day. It also has an SPF 15 so it will protect you slightly, but don’t rely on that for your sun-battling strategy. It contains salicylic acid for battling the grease and helps prevent emerging acne breakouts. It’s oil-free, non-comedogenic, and oil-free so it’s safe for just about anyone. If you want breathable coverage yet still actually be covered, Neutrogena brings it home.
